**Postmortem timeline — Kiosko watchdog incident**

09:14 — Watchdog on the Ferndale lobby kiosks began force-restarting the app every 40 seconds. Cause: a stale health endpoint returned after the overnight update. Restarts masked the real failure for two hours. Security impact: none observed; session storage was wiped on each restart. The offending update is identified by the token below.

build token for fajof-yahof: htk4_869f

Subject: Shared lab access — please read

All assistants: from next week the Marrowgate lab on Level 5 is shared with the Tindervale analytics team. Booking is mandatory via the wall calendar; no drop-ins. Clear benches at the end of each session and log equipment use in the binder by the sink. Tindervale staff have their own entrance on the north side; ours remains the east door. That door has been rekeyed, so your old code no longer works. Use the new code below.

staff pass of kawip-hawef = bdg-QLP-2

Before migrating Sproutly's plant-watering scheduler to the new zone-based model, stop the legacy cron worker and confirm no watering jobs are mid-run; interrupted jobs are not resumed automatically. Run the bundled schema migration, which converts per-plant timers into zone schedules and may take several minutes on larger installs. Once it completes, the service will refuse to start until its zone settings are populated. Populate them using the configuration values shown below, adjusting only the timezone if needed.

service settings:
[casax]
port = 6379
team = rusir
host = casax.zemvarhq.corp
region = outer-4
access_code = ac_9808ce
timeout_ms = 1500